What better way to spend the stupidly early hours of the morning (roughly a 5 am start...) to wake up the kids and take them down to the yearly balloon launches in the Parliamentary Triangle of Canberra. You would think that most people would just spend the morning in bed... but I guess, if you happen to be in Canberra at this time of the year, it is a really nice event to go to if you rouse yourself for the early morning start. But, if you do plan on coming... well, plan on getting here a little bit ahead of time... or parking a fair distance away, as there are actually quite a lot of people who DO manage to wake up early to catch this event!
Canberra is known for its balloons floating around all around the year, but they usually launch from the outer suburbs. On this one occasion in the year, a whole heap of balloon teams gather at the foreshore of Lake Burley Griffin in a crowded space to launch in the wee hours.
There are all sorts of interesting balloons on display... many of them are regular shaped, but with interesting colour schemes... and in the past, we have had a whale and a sloth which are always hits with the kids.
Plus, the Air Force always brings a couple of interesting shaped ones...
The stillness of the morning is broken by the gentle murmur of the crowds, and the roar of the balloon flares...
